WebCardiac event monitors. A cardiac event monitor is a device that you control to record the electrical activity of your heart (ECG). This device is about the size of a pager. It records your heart rate and rhythm. Cardiac event monitors are used when you need long-term monitoring of symptoms that occur less than daily. Web16 de mai. de 2024 · An implantable loop recorder (ILR) is a heart-monitoring device that monitors heart activity for up to three years. This little device enables a doctor to monitor a patient’s heartbeat remotely. Healthcare providers may recommend ILR to patients with arrhythmia, syncope (unexplained fainting), and an unexplained stroke.
